pengaruh penggunaan e-lkpd berbasis liveworksheets terhadap motivasi dan hasil belajar siswa pada materi sistem ekskresi di sman 1 inuman
This study aims to determine the effect of using Liveworksheets based e-LKPD on student motivation and learning outcomes on the human excretory system material at SMAN 1 Inuman. The background of this study is based on the low involvement and motivation of students in biology learning, especially on abstract materials such as the excretory system. Liveworksheets based interactive learning media is expected to be an attractive alternative to increase student participation and understanding. This study used a quasi-experimental method with a Pretest Posttest Control Group Design. The research sample consisted of two classes, namely the experimental class using Liveworksheets based e-LKPD and the control class using conventional LKPD, each totaling 26 students. Data collection was carried out through a learning motivation questionnaire and a cognitive learning outcome test. Data were analyzed using a t-test and N-Gain calculation to see the effect of Liveworksheets based e-LKPD on motivation and learning outcomes.
The results of the study showed that the use of Liveworksheets based e-LKPD significantly influenced student motivation and learning outcomes. The average learning motivation questionnaire score for the experimental class was 77.2 (high category), while the control class was 67.6 (high category), with the t-test results showing a significance value of 0.001 < 0.05. The increase in motivation and learning outcomes was influenced by the characteristics of the Liveworksheets media which were interactive, visually appealing, and provided automatic feedback. This media helped students understand the abstract concept of the excretory system through activities such as matching excretory organs, sequencing the process of urine formation, and watching videos about excretory disorders and technology. Thus, it can be concluded that Liveworksheets based e-LKPD is effective in increasing student motivation and learning outcomes in the Excretory System material.
